Mr. Markku Kinnunen, Research in energy and climate policy preparation focuses on how public policies are designed, implemented, and evaluated to address long-term sustainability challenges through effective governance and regulatory instruments. It examines the interaction between climate targets, energy system transformation, and policy stringency, particularly their influence on investment incentives, security of supply, and system resilience. A key theme is the alignment between democratic processes, stakeholder participation, and policy outcomes, including public consultation and institutional accountability. The research also analyses incentive-based regulation of natural monopolies, especially electricity distribution systems, and its impact on reliability and quality of supply. Comparative policy analysis is used to assess national responses to supranational climate commitments and cross-sector policy coherence. Methodologically, the field integrates economic analysis, regulatory theory, and empirical evaluation to balance environmental ambition, economic efficiency, and social acceptance in low-carbon transitions.
